This paper describes a new Darlington AC-coupled mixer operating at 8 GHz with improved figure-of-merits. This Darlington AC-coupled mixer along with a simple AC-coupling mixer used for reference are implemented in a 0.35 μm SiGe bipolar process. The supply voltage and current consumption are 3.2 V and 28 mA. In the Darlington AC-coupling mixer, the conversion gain, the operating bandwidth, and the NF are found to be improved by 13 dB, 180 MHz, and 10 dB, respectively. These improved figure-of-merit results from the use of the Darlington cell in the transconductance stage of the AC-coupling mixer.
